Hey, I've just joined the powerbase community, but it hasn't been too pleasant. I got a PowerBase 180 (tower) from a friend who said it was work but that there was a few problems with the hard drive. I set it up, worked fine (running MacOS 8.5), and began to customize some settings (network setup, file sharing, remote access stuff, general controlls, activating control strip, moving arround a few extensions, thats about it) and moved some icons arround. Nothing much? Well, when I restarted, the computer would start up, show the desktop and folder/ program icons (essentially the end of startup) and unfortunately would not change the hourglass to the cursor, preventing me from doing anything. I restarted, ran Disk First Aid, and it said there was an error in the HD that couldn't be fixed. Same problem after it went through startup process. Rebuilt desktop: same prob. Extensions off, zapp PRAM, same prob. I'd use a CD to start up, but the drive seems to be broken. Any ideas of what the heck happened and how to fix it?
